Aleesha Nash

M.F.A., writer, director, and visual artist whose credits include Fred Rogers Productions’ Donkey Hodie. Her theatre work has been seen Off-Broadway at Cherry Lane Theatre, The National Black Theatre, The Flea Theater, Primary Stages, The Wild Project, Kraine Theater and The Drama League in New York City. Ms. Nash has received the Goddard College Engaged Artist Award and the Primary Stages’ Mary Louise Rockwell Award.

Instructor Statement:

“Storytelling has always been a significant part of my life, shaping my ideals and inspiring courage. The stories I loved as a child, filled with fearless characters, taught me the profound importance of imagination and instilled in me the knowledge that stories can drive real change, which I have been fortunate to carry forward with me into adulthood and my own career in storytelling. My teaching approach is strongly informed by my belief that curiosity and collaboration are essential in telling authentic and compelling stories. In the classroom, my aim is to challenge and engage you, while at the same time encouraging deeper inquiry into the world and pulling from personal experiences to promote new and exciting discoveries. The classroom is also a powerful place for collaboration, I utilize small group conversations, role-plays, brainstorming sessions, and group projects and presentations to help you and your peers develop compelling story beats, resonant themes, and memorable characters. I am so excited about the educational journey that lies ahead of us! Together, we will set and achieve our goals, embrace the power of social learning, and glean valuable insight from real-world applications. I continually strive to create a learning environment that is safe, inclusive, and celebrates diversity in all its forms, and my dedication to staying aware of industry trends ensures that my students are prepared to take the next steps to reaching their writing goals.
